CANTERBURY-BANKSTOWN, Australia, Feb. 14,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Introduction

In 2025, Australia's home battery storage sector has seen explosive growth. Since July, the federal Cheaper Home Batteries Program has driven the installation of around 100,000 household battery systems, delivering over 2 GWh of storage capacity in under four months. This surge has been fueled by a government-backed discount of around 30% on upfront costs and strong consumer demand. Meanwhile, data from the Clean Energy Regulator shows that validated installations through August 2025 have already reached 43,517 units, amounting to approximately 825 MWh of capacity.

As one of the promising renewable energy markets in the world, Australia continues to lead in residential solar adoption. 2. Product Reliability

Systems must deliver consistent performance with low failure rates and demonstrate the ability to adapt to local conditions, including harsh environments. In addition to reliability, certification compliance is a critical consideration in the Australian market.

Felicitysolar's inverters and lithium battery packs are certified in accordance with relevant Australian requirements. The LUX-X-48100LG01-US lithium battery is listed on the CEC approved battery list, while the T-REX-10KLP3G01 hybrid inverter has passed the AS4777-2:2020 standard, meeting local grid connection compliance requirements for solar inverters in Australia.
